Once again Cranbrook Institute of Science is joining with Montana State 
University - Northern to offer a paleontology field opportunity. We will 
assist in the recovery of dinosaur eggs, egg shells and nests and 
prospect other fossil sites in the hills and gullies of northern Montana 
in an effort to reconstruct ancient vertebrate ecology.

People (like you) who are interested in earth science field work are 
invited to participate in all phases of a paleontological expedition. 
Hadrosaur nests with eggs, egg shells and baby bones have been removed 
from the area. Note: This is public land; personal collecting is not 
permitted.
